Oakley Sunglasses Oakley is mostly known for their quality sunglasses and ski goggles, and was founded by Jim Jannard in California,USA in 1975, where he developed motorbike hand grips, and then sold them at motocross events. He called them “The Oakley Grip”, and were very different to any other grips riders had been using. In the 1980’s he moved on to goggles and sunglasses, and is now a world leader in innovative design, creating new and exciting products.
Oakley sunglasses are engineered to maintain a comfortable, secure fit. The company’s patented “Three-Point Fit” ensures that each frame makes contact only at the bridge of the nose and behind the temples. This retains optics in perfect alignment and eliminates the discomfort of ordinary frames that hook the ears and mount with unbalanced pressure points.

Every single pair of Oakley polarized sunglasses achieves 99.9% efficiency in blocking polarized light waves. Harsh glare is caused by light waves bouncing off flat surfaces and water, and can be up to 10 times as bright as ambient light. With Oakley polarized lenses you’ll definitely keep the sun from impeding your vision.
Oakley’s polarization technology surpasses industry standards for clarity, performance and durability. Common techniques of incorporating polarization films into lenses by lamination (using adhesive to sandwich the film between lens layers) and drop forming (sandwiching then heating and pressing over contoured forms) can cause haziness and optical distortion. Oakley uses an injection-moulding process to infuse the lens material around the filter. This liquid fusion creates bonding at a molecular level, allowing the filter to achieve the highest possible level of performance.
The sun emits radiation in the form of tiny particles of energy called photons. The radiation includes harmful ultra-violet (uva & uvb) radiation, which is known to cause long term damage to our skin and eyes. The uv400 lenses fitted to all Oakley sunglasses provide 100% protection against this harmful UV radiation.
Plutonite is used for all Oakley lenses. It is made of polycarbonate, making the lenses lightweight, offering superior comfort, clarity and protection against ultraviolet radiation and impact resistance. In fact, this impact resistant material blocks out 100% of all UVA, UVB and UVC radiation. The protection is formulated into the lens material, as opposed to a thin surface film that can become scratched, leaving dilated pupils exposed to ultraviolet leaks. Shielding has nothing to do with the darkness or colour of the lens, so even clear non-tinted Oakley lenses will still provide full UV protection.

Filter categories:Lenses are available in various shades and a range of colours and tints. The European standard helps you choose sunglasses by providing a system of filter categories that describe the darkness of the tint. These filter categories are explained below. It is important to remember that all Oakley sunglasses offer the same level of UV protection whatever the filter category.
Filter category 080 - 100% light transmittance
clear or very light tint
recommended use - dimmed brightness
Filter category 143 - 80% light transmittance
light tint
recommended use - low brightness
Filter category 218 - 43% light transmittance
medium tint
recommended use - medium brightness
Filter category 38 - 18% light transmittance
dark tint
recommended use - high brightness
Filter category 43 - 8% light transmittance
very dark tint
recommended use - exceptionally high brightness
Categories 0 - 3 are not suitable for driving at night or under conditions of poor light
Category 4 is not suitable for driving or road use.
